WebAug 26, 2024 · Here are a few necessary terms for reading nautical chart symbols for depth: Fathoms: While most modern charts mark depth in meters, older nautical charts may use fathoms, abbreviated as FM. A fathom is equal to 6 feet. Depth measurements in fathoms that are not an even multiple of six are listed using subscripts. WebMar 15, 2024 · If the scale is 1:30,000 it means that 1 inch on your chart equals 30,000 inches in real life. That means 1 inch is about 0.4 nautical miles. WebMar 14, 2024 · There are 52 VNC charts published at 1:500,000 scale covering the entirety of Canada. The VNC Charts are intended for visual navigation for operations at or below 12,500′ above sea level. There are 7 VTA charts published at 1:250,000 scale covering high traffic areas – Vancouver, Calgary, Edmonton, Winnipeg, Toronto, Ottawa, and Montreal.

WebProjection identification. Chart projection is a method by which we represent a curved surface (the earth) on a flat piece of paper (the chart). The Mercator projection is the most commonly used for nautical charts. Any chart, whether they’re paper charts or electronic, need to make information easy to read. Because the real world is large, we shrink it onto charts. A scale that is 1:10,000 means that anyone one unit of measure on the chart is 10,000 times bigger in real life.
